1 1/2 lb. ground beef salt and pepper or seasoned salt 1 Tbsp. vegetable oil 1 large onion, sliced 1/2 c. warm water 1 beef bouillon cube 1 Tbsp. flour 1/2 c. Pepper Jack cheese, shredded 1/4 c. Colby Jack cheese, shredded 4 garlic toasts (frozen) Preheat oven to 425 degrees. Season meat. Shape into 4 oval patties and make a depression in the center. Heat vegetable oil over medium heat. Cook patties for 5 minutes and flip. When patties are almost fully cooked, top with onion and season with salt and pepper. Cover and cook for another 7 to 10 minutes. Remove patties; cook onion another 5 minutes. In a cup, mix beef bouillon with warm water; let set a few minutes. Add flour to the onion mixture; stir for about a minute. Add beef broth mixture and stir. Reduce heat to medium-low and let sauce thicken. Once thickened, add patties back and let set for about 5 minutes over low heat. Toast garlic bread in oven for 4 to 5 minutes. Remove toast from oven. Preheat broiler. Top each with onion gravy mixture, patty, more onion gravy and shredded cheeses. Place under broiler 1 to 2 minutes, or until cheese melts. Let cool slightly and serve.
